MECHANICAL ENGINEERINGJOB DESCRIPTION
• Mechanical engineers design, develop, build, and test mechanical and thermal devices like tools, engines and machines
• Design and oversee the manufacturing of products ranging from medical devices to new batteries.
AVERAGE SALARIES
United States $ 81, 000
Texas $ 79, 000
Houston $ 92, 000
Mcallen $ 77, 000
Number of Jobs in 2012: 258, 100 jobs

ELECTRICAL ENGINEERINGJOBS DESCRIPTION
• Electrical engineers design, develop and test the manufacturing of electrical equipment like electric motors, navigation systems, communication systems and others.
• Electrical engineers work mainly in research and development industries. They also work mainly in offices.
AVERAGE SALARIES
United States $ 83, 000
Texas $ 81, 000
Houston $ 94, 000
Mcallen $ 79, 000
Number of jobs in 2012: 306, 100
